About
Masterchannel is an advanced AI mastering service designed to meet the standards of professional mastering engineers. Unlike services that rely on presets or generic large-scale music datasets, Masterchannel has developed its own proprietary mastering technology in collaboration with experienced engineers and producers. Every track is processed completely individually — the system identifies the specific genre influences, detects sonic problems, and makes targeted adjustments to enhance the music while preserving its original authenticity. Masters produced by Masterchannel are consistently optimized for all playback environments, whether that's in a car, on a phone, over the radio, or in a club. All outputs meet the latest loudness and format requirements for major digital streaming platforms. Human mastering engineers continuously review and validate the AI's results, ensuring a quality bar that pure automation alone cannot guarantee. The service caters to artists and bedroom producers on its Artist plan, working producers who want additional polish via the professional Wez Clarke Clone engine on its Professional plan, and labels or studios needing high-volume processing and white-label capabilities on the Partner plan. Masterchannel explicitly commits to ethical practices: your music is never used for AI training or any third-party purpose. Trusted by notable artists and producers including collaborators with OneRepublic, Tiësto, and Ane Brun, Masterchannel is built for anyone who needs release-ready masters at scale.

Cons
- No Free Tier: Masterchannel has no free plan; all access requires a paid subscription, which may be a barrier for hobbyists or one-time users.
- Limited Manual Control: Unlike DAW-based mastering, users cannot fine-tune individual processing parameters, making it less suitable for engineers who prefer hands-on control.
- Higher-Tier Plans Are Costly: The Partner plan at $79/month may be expensive for smaller studios or independent labels not processing high volumes of tracks.

The Wez Clarke Clone is a special mastering mode available on the Professional plan and above that applies an additional layer of polish inspired by the mastering style of renowned engineer Wez Clarke, providing extra character and refinement to your tracks.
Masterchannel offers three plans: Artist ($15/mo billed annually) for individual artists and bedroom producers; Professional ($19/mo billed annually) with added Wez Clarke Clone and platform-specific resolutions; and Partner ($79/mo billed annually) for labels and studios needing multi-user access and white-label capabilities.
